A Postgraduate Certificate in Statistical Analysis for Bioinformatics equips students with the advanced statistical skills crucial for analyzing complex biological data. The program focuses on practical application, ensuring graduates are job-ready upon completion.
Learning outcomes typically include proficiency in statistical programming languages like R and Python, mastering techniques such as hypothesis testing, regression analysis, and machine learning algorithms relevant to bioinformatics. Students develop a strong understanding of experimental design and data visualization, critical for interpreting results and communicating findings effectively within the bioinformatics field.
The duration of a Postgraduate Certificate in Statistical Analysis for Bioinformatics varies depending on the institution, but generally ranges from a few months to a year of part-time or full-time study.
